Traffic Signage and Pavement Markings

The Traffic Division is responsible for deciding where and what type of traffic signs and pavement markings are installed in the City. This includes all parking signs, stop signs, speed limit signs and other types of regulatory signs, as well as all warning signs. Pavement markings include lane and intersection markings, as well as crosswalks.

We use the Manual of Uniform Traffic Control Devices and the Pedestrian Crossing Control Manual, which are produced by the Transportation Association of Canada, as guides. The manuals establish criteria and conditions under which traffic signs and markings may be used. This ensures that signs and markings are installed as uniformly and consistently as possible throughout the City.
